Types of Tile Materials for Outdoor Kitchens

Consider various tile materials for outdoor kitchens such as ceramic, porcelain, marble, travertine, slate, granite, and terracotta. Evaluate each material’s suitability for your unique outdoor kitchen needs.

Ceramic

Ceramic tiles offer a versatile and cost-effective option for outdoor kitchen flooring. They come in a wide range of colors, styles, and patterns, allowing homeowners to customize their space uniquely.

These tiles are easy to clean and maintain, making them an ideal choice for areas that face spills and stains.

Despite their many benefits, ceramic tiles have some limitations in outdoor environments. They can crack in freezing temperatures if not properly installed with the right underlayment.

Homeowners should opt for higher density ceramic tiles designed specifically for outdoor use to ensure durability against weather elements. Ceramic tile surfaces can also become slippery when wet; choosing textured options or ones with a slip-resistant coating is advisable for safety in the outdoor kitchen area.

Porcelain

Porcelain tiles stand out as a top choice for outdoor kitchen flooring due to their durability and ease of maintenance. They resist stains, scratches, and fading from sunlight, making them perfect for areas exposed to the elements.

These tiles also come in a wide variety of designs, enabling homeowners to find the right style that complements their outdoor living space. Porcelain tile for outdoor kitchens offers both beauty and function, ensuring your cooking area remains stylish and practical year-round.

Marble

Moving from porcelain to marble, homeowners find a world of elegance for their outdoor kitchens. Marble tiles offer unmatched beauty with their unique veining and color variations, making every piece stand out as part of your outdoor kitchen tile style.

This natural stone exudes luxury and can elevate the look of any outdoor cooking space.

Marble stands up well to heat, a crucial factor for surfaces near grills or stoves. However, it requires more maintenance than other materials because it’s porous and prone to stains if not sealed properly.

Regular sealing helps protect its surface, preserving the opulent finish against outdoor elements and enhancing your home’s value with its timeless appeal.

Travertine

Travertine is a durable natural stone tile that adds timeless elegance to outdoor kitchens. Its earthy tones and unique textures create a warm and inviting atmosphere, perfect for cooking and entertaining outdoors.

With proper sealing, travertine can withstand the elements and provides a non-slip surface, making it an ideal choice for outdoor kitchen flooring or countertops. Its natural variation adds character to the space, giving homeowners a stylish yet practical option for their outdoor culinary haven.

When selecting materials for your outdoor kitchen, consider travertine for its durability and aesthetic appeal. Whether used as flooring or countertops, this natural stone brings warmth and sophistication to your outdoor living space while standing up to the demands of cooking in the open air.

Slate

Slate tiles are a popular choice for outdoor kitchens due to their natural beauty and durability. These tiles offer a rustic and earthy look that can complement various outdoor kitchen designs.

The inherent slip-resistant surface of slate makes it ideal for outdoor spaces, providing safety for homeowners and their guests. Slate is known for its resilience against extreme weather conditions, making it suitable for year-round use in outdoor settings.

This low-maintenance option is resistant to stains and easy to clean, which adds convenience to the upkeep of an outdoor kitchen space.

When selecting slate tiles for your outdoor kitchen, consider the color variation and natural texture inherent in each piece. This varying appearance contributes to the unique character of slate surfaces, adding visual interest to your flooring or countertops.

Granite

Granite is a popular choice for outdoor kitchen tiles due to its durability and resistance to heat, scratches, and stains. This natural stone tile provides a timeless and elegant look while standing up well to the elements.

With its non-slip surface, granite is an ideal option for outdoor kitchen flooring or countertops, offering both practicality and style. Homeowners seeking durable and low-maintenance tile materials for their outdoor kitchens should consider granite as it adds a touch of luxury while withstanding the wear and tear of outdoor cooking spaces.

Incorporating granite tiles into your outdoor kitchen design not only enhances the aesthetic appeal but also ensures longevity in high-traffic areas. Its resilience against weather conditions makes it an excellent choice for homeowners looking for long-lasting and stylish tiling options that will elevate their outdoor living space.

Terracotta

Terracotta tiles are a popular choice for outdoor kitchens due to their durability and natural warmth. These clay-based tiles offer a rustic, earthy look that complements outdoor living spaces.

Terracotta is best suited for warm climates as it can crack in freezing temperatures. It requires regular sealing to protect against moisture and stains, but with proper maintenance, terracotta tiles can provide a charming and timeless appeal to your outdoor kitchen.

The Pros and Cons of Tile for Outdoor Kitchens

When used in outdoor kitchens, tile offers easy maintenance and a wide range of design options. Read on for an insightful discussion on the subject.

Outdoor kitchen tile offers numerous advantages for homeowners. It is durable, able to withstand heavy foot traffic, furniture movement, and outdoor cooking activities. Its waterproof nature makes it resistant to stains, water damage, and mold growth while providing easy cleaning and maintenance.

Additionally, outdoor kitchen tiles are available in a variety of styles and colors allowing homeowners to create a personalized design that matches their outdoor living space. The non-slip feature of many outdoor tiles provides safety for families and guests during wet weather or around the pool area.

With its durability and low-maintenance features coupled with a range of stylish options, outdoor kitchen tiles offer homeowners an attractive yet practical solution for their patio flooring or countertops.

Transitioning from the benefits of using tile in outdoor kitchens, it’s important to consider some potential drawbacks. One key disadvantage of utilizing tile for outdoor kitchen spaces is the susceptibility to cracking or chipping due to extreme temperature changes and heavy impact.

This issue could lead to maintenance and replacement costs over time, especially with certain materials such as ceramic or marble. Another downside is that certain types of tile may also become slippery when wet, posing a safety hazard in outdoor cooking areas.

Moreover, it’s essential to note that despite regular sealing and grouting efforts, some types of tiles may still require more upkeep compared to other flooring options designed specifically for outdoor use.

Tips for Installing Tile in Outdoor Kitchens

Ensure proper sealing and grouting when installing outdoor kitchen tile. Choose the right tile for different surfaces and work with a professional for installation to achieve a stunning outdoor kitchen.

Ensuring proper sealing and grouting

To ensure a long-lasting outdoor kitchen tile installation, it’s crucial to properly seal and grout the tiles. Sealing helps protect the tiles from moisture, stains, and damage caused by exposure to outdoor elements.

This is especially important for natural stone and terracotta tiles. Grouting not only provides a finished look but also prevents water from seeping beneath the tiles, helping maintain their integrity over time.

Properly sealed and grouted tiles contribute to the overall durability and aesthetics of your outdoor kitchen. It’s essential to follow manufacturer recommendations for sealing frequency and use high-quality grout that is suitable for outdoor applications such as epoxy or polymer-modified varieties.

Choosing the right tile for different surfaces

When selecting the right tile for different surfaces, it’s crucial to consider factors like durability, slip-resistance, and maintenance. For outdoor kitchen flooring, opt for non-slip tiles with a textured surface such as slate or porcelain.

Natural stone tiles work well for countertops due to their durability and heat-resistant properties. Keep in mind that terracotta is an ideal choice for creating a warm and inviting atmosphere on outdoor kitchen walls.

To enhance safety in your outdoor kitchen, prioritize selecting non-slip options for flooring surfaces using materials such as slate or porcelain. When choosing countertops, prioritize durable natural stone tiles that are resistant to heat.

FAQs

Porcelain, ceramic, and natural stone tiles are ideal choices for outdoor kitchens due to their durability and resistance to moisture and heat.
Larger format tiles such as 12×24 inches or 18×18 inches are commonly used for outdoor kitchen flooring as they create a seamless look with fewer grout lines.
It is not recommended to use regular indoor tiles in an outdoor kitchen as they may not withstand exposure to the elements and temperature changes.
Regularly sweep or hose off debris, clean with a mild detergent, and seal the grout annually to maintain the appearance and longevity of your outdoor kitchen tiles.
Neutral tones like beige, gray, or earthy hues tend to complement the natural surroundings of an outdoor space while also helping to conceal dirt and stains.
